WebMay 21, 2012 · Insert the screwdriver into the head of the screw. Give the end of the screw driver a good whack with a hammer. This should be enough to either break through the paint, or put a dent into the screw head. Without removing the screwdriver, press down and slowly unscrew the screw. WebJan 1, 2024 · Turn the adjusting knob on the locking pliers so that it takes both hands to clamp them shut on the screw head and squashes some small flats into the screw head when shut. Hold your locking pliers flat against the wall Clamp them shut Unscrew You want the pliers so tight that you can barely get them clamped. WebApr 13, 2024 · For Screw Heads At or Under the Wall: For screw heads that are flush with the wood surface or slightly below, you will need to use your screw extractor set. Using your drill, make a 1/8 inch deep hole in the top of the screw head. It should be large enough to accept the largest screw extractor that will fit the head.
